Subject: TileForge cache key rotation — heads up

Hey future maintainers,

We rotated the credentials for the TileForge render cache this morning after the old key hit its one-year mark. Nothing broke, but any local scripts hitting the cache warmer will need updating. Config lives in the usual deploy repo. For reference, the new key for the internal cache service is below.

gateway credential: kto3_qfe

// Poll interval (seconds) for the Corvane partner SFTP drop.
// Partner uploads land hourly; polling faster than 300s triggers their
// connection throttle and we get locked out for an hour. Do not lower
// this without confirming the throttle window changed. Retry logic
// lives in sftp_fetch.go. Interval last validated against the
// following build.

trace token, tawep-fahif: htk3_b58

Check that implement identifiers, GPS fixes, and hour-meter readings are range-checked, that malformed frames are quarantined rather than dropped silently, and that quarantine counters surface in the plugin health endpoint. Confirm replay protection on the CAN-bus bridge is enabled in all deployed configurations. Record evidence for each check, then obtain sign-off from the accountable gateway owner, whose full name appears below.

signatory, tajof-yaweg: Ralix Istdor

Finance Review Summary — Lanterro Launch Plan

The board is asked to note the financial position on the Lanterro handheld scanner launch. Development spend closed 4% under budget. Projected first-year revenue is contingent on the Westmere retail partnership concluding by March. Marketing allocation is front-loaded into the first two quarters, with break-even modelled at month fourteen. Contingency reserves remain untouched. A confidential note on the broader commercial strategy is appended below.

management briefing: Project Ulavan slips by two quarters because of the staffing delay.